2.3 Time setting

By default, time is configured in the sensor. After a complete discharge, the internal time of
the sensors has to be updated. To update the time, connect your sensor to your computer
and add an empty text file named "time.txt" in the main folder. The file must imperatively
be saved in ".txt" format. When the time is not correctly configured, your files are saved in
the "NO_DATE" folder in the sensor. If the time is correctly set your files are saved in a
folder with the measurement date. If you start the sensors from the watch or the
application, the time is automatically updated and you thus don't need to follow the
instructions hereabove.

2.4 Fix the Sensors

PhysiRun lab package contains two rubber clips to fix the sensors on the shoes and elastic
straps to measure barefoot running, for example.
